Hi,

I have just had a 8.6kwh battery solution installed and its not functioning as expected. I want to make use of the night time octopus tariff until I get around to adding solar panels at a later date.

I have a schedule 1 setup in fox cloud for 23:30 - 06:00 however its not adhering to the schedule. Schedule 2 is switched off. When work start is enabled in the settings the inverter will instantly start charge the battery at the full 5kwh, I've yet to see the battery discharge to the house.
Could this be a problem with the setup?

Its running in grid-mode with the grid cable and CT clamp installed. it was my understanding that the batteries should discharge outside of this schedule to provide load to the house or am i missing something?

If you have your work mode set to self-use, and there are no charge periods set then any spare battery will be used to cover the home loads.

Can you check that schedule 2 is entered as 00:00-00:00 as if there are times set, even if the charge switch is not set the battery will not discharge.

Secondly can you check what your minsoc settings are, these should normally be set to 10%, any higher and your inverter will try and charge them the moment it starts up to meet that target.

Finally is it reporting your home load correctly ? - can you post an image of your energy flow (real time data) screen.
